Lin Mo
Lin Mo (Simplified Chinese characters, Chinese:林墨; born Huang Qi-lin Simplified Chinese characters, Chinese:黄其淋 on January 6, 2002) is a Chinese singer, songwriter, dancer, and actor. He is best known for being a member of the boy group Into1 after placing sixth on the finale of ''Produce Camp 2021''. He is also a member of the boy group Yi’an Music Club. Early life and Career 2014-present: Debut with Yi'an Music Club, Solo debut and Debut with Into1 From 2013, Lin Mo was a trainee under TF Entertainment. He participated in various variety shows and made his acting debut under the company. After his contract expired in November 2016, he left TF Entertainmen and joined Original Plan Entertainment In 2017, Lin Mo became a first generation student of 'Yi'an Music Club', the group made their official debut on March 30, 2017 with their single "Chitty Bang Bang Bang". Chongqing
Chongqing ( or ; ; Sichuanese dialects, Sichuanese pronunciation: , Standard Mandarin pronunciation: ), Postal Romanization, alternately romanized as Chungking (), is a Direct-administered municipalities of China, municipality in Southwest China. The official abbreviation of the city, "" (), was approved by the State Council of the People's Republic of China, State Council on 18 April 1997. This abbreviation is derived from the old name of a part of the Jialing River that runs through Chongqing and feeds into the Yangtze River. Administratively, it is one of the four municipalities under the direct administration of the Government of China, central government of the People's Republic of China (the other three are Beijing, Shanghai, and Tianjin), and the only such municipality located deep inland. Mandopop Singers
Mandopop or Mandapop refers to Mandarin popular music. The genre has its origin in the jazz-influenced popular music of 1930s Shanghai known as Shidaiqu; with later influences coming from Japanese enka, Hong Kong's Cantopop, Taiwan's Hokkien pop, and in particular the Campus Song folk movement of the 1970s. 'Mandopop' may be used as a general term to describe popular songs performed in Mandarin. Though Mandopop predates Cantopop, the English term was coined around 1980 after "Cantopop" became a popular term for describing popular songs in Cantonese. "Mandopop" was used to describe Mandarin-language popular songs of that time, some of which were versions of Cantopop songs sung by the same singers with different lyrics to suit the different rhyme and tonal patterns of Mandarin. Mandopop is categorized as a subgenre of commercial Chinese-language music within C-pop. Into1 Members
Into1 (''pronounced as Into One'') is a multi-national Chinese boy group, formed through the 2021 reality show ''Produce Camp 2021'' (Chuang 2021) on Tencent Video. The group consists of 11 members: Liu Yu, Santa, Rikimaru, Mika, Nine, Lin Mo, Bo Yuan, Zhang Jiayuan, Patrick, Zhou Keyu, Liu Zhang. History Pre-debut Before ''Produce Camp 2021'' began, many of the members of Into1 were previously active in the entertainment industry. Liu Yu debuted as an actor in the 2020 series "Dear Herbal Lord" and in 2018, participated in iQiyi’s national cultural talent contest, The Chinese Youth, placing 2nd. Bo Yuan is a member of the Chinese boy group 'ZERO-G'. Rikimaru and Santa are members of the Japanese-Chinese boy group 'WARPs Up'. Mika is a member of the Japanese boy group 'INTERSECTION' Patrick made his acting debut in the Thai GMMTV series The Gifted: Graduation.
